    Owing to expanding acceptance of a westernized lifestyle, rising economic development, and rising population, the burden of chronic illnesses is rising significantly over the world. About 133 million Americans suffer from chronic illnesses, accounting for more than 40% of the nation's population and being typically incurable and continuous. It is anticipated that by 2020, there would be 157 million people worldwide, 81 million of whom will have various illnesses. Around 8% of children aged 5 to 17 reported having limited activities because of at least one chronic illness or impairment, while around 50% of adults report having a chronic condition.

    The market in North America is distinguished by the region's long-standing CDMO presence. Along with this element, expanding partnerships between pharmaceutical firms and CDMOs providing a wide variety of services are to blame for the region's leading market share globally. The pharmaceutical business is supported by an estimated 300 pharmaceutical contract development and manufacturing companies (CDMOs). The industry is still incredibly fragmented despite rising merger and acquisition (M&A) activity; the top five CDMOs account for only 15% of the market as a whole.
